Understanding Your Skin Type
Before diving into the essentials of Your Body Care Routine, it’s crucial to identify your skin type. Understanding whether your skin is oily, dry, combination, or sensitive can significantly influence the products you choose. For instance, individuals with dry skin may benefit from richer, emollient formulations, while those with oily skin might find lighter, gel-based products more suitable. Tailoring your approach based on your skin’s unique needs is the first step toward achieving glowing skin essentials.
The Importance of Cleansing
A fundamental aspect of Your Body Care Routine is cleansing. Removing dirt, sweat, and impurities helps to prevent clogged pores and dullness. Select a gentle body wash that caters to your skin type. For example, a hydrating body wash with natural oils or cream can work wonders for dry skin, while a clarifying gel can help balance oilier complexions.
Opt for cleansers that contain natural ingredients like aloe vera or coconut oil. These elements not only cleanse but also provide nourishment. The goal is to achieve a clean slate for the subsequent steps in your body care regimen.
Exfoliation: Buffing Away the Old
Exfoliation is the magic key to achieving smooth and soft skin. By sloughing off dead skin cells, you reveal fresh, new skin beneath. Regular exfoliation can improve skin texture, enhance absorption of subsequent products, and promote an even skin tone.
There are two main types of exfoliation: physical and chemical. Physical exfoliants, such as scrubs or exfoliating gloves, manually remove dead skin. On the other hand, chemical exfoliants contain ingredients like alpha-hydroxy acids (AHAs) or beta-hydroxy acids (BHAs), which dissolve dead skin cells without the need for scrubbing. Glowing skin essentials often include these potent ingredients, as they provide an effortless glow.
Incorporate exfoliation into your routine 1-3 times per week, depending on your skin’s sensitivity. This step is crucial for maintaining smooth and soft skin and can dramatically enhance the overall appearance of your body.
Hydration: The Heart of Body Care
Once your skin is cleansed and exfoliated, the next step is hydration. A good moisturizer is indispensable in any Body Care Checklist. Look for products enriched with ingredients like hyaluronic acid, glycerin, or shea butter, which are known for their hydrating properties.
Applying moisturizer immediately after showering helps to lock in moisture, preventing dryness and promoting softness. For those seeking extra nourishment, consider body oils or balms that offer a more intensive treatment. These products can be particularly beneficial during colder months when skin tends to become more parched.
Special Treatments for Targeted Care
Sometimes, specific areas of the body may need extra attention. Whether it’s dry elbows, cracked heels, or rough patches on the arms, targeted treatments can help. Look for products that contain urea or salicylic acid to tackle rough spots effectively. These ingredients are particularly adept at softening tough skin, making them invaluable in your quest for smooth and soft skin.
For dry hands, a thick hand cream or cuticle oil can work wonders. Always remember to apply these treatments consistently to reap the benefits fully.
Sun Protection: Shielding Your Glow
No Body Care Checklist would be complete without sun protection. Ultraviolet (UV) rays can wreak havoc on your skin, leading to premature aging, sunburn, and increased risk of skin cancer. Incorporating a broad-spectrum sunscreen into your Your Body Care Routine is non-negotiable.
Choose a sunscreen with at least SPF 30 and reapply every two hours, especially if you’re outdoors. Look for formulations that also include antioxidants like vitamin C or E, which help combat free radical damage. This proactive measure ensures that your skin remains not only soft and smooth but also beautifully radiant.
Embracing a Holistic Approach
While products play a significant role, remember that a holistic approach is paramount. Hydration, nutrition, and lifestyle choices can profoundly impact skin health. Drinking plenty of water, consuming a balanced diet rich in vitamins and antioxidants, and getting enough sleep are all crucial for maintaining glowing skin essentials.
Consider incorporating skin-loving foods into your diet, such as avocados, nuts, and berries. These nourish your skin from within, complementing your external body care regimen.
